Training Data
The dataset used to teach a machine learning model to recognize patterns and make accurate predictions.
What Is Training Data?
Training data is the collection of examples used to teach a machine learning model how to perform its task. The quality, quantity, and representativeness of training data directly determines model accuracy. For a spam filter, training data includes labeled examples of spam and legitimate emails
For a demand forecasting model, it includes historical sales data. Businesses need to ensure their training data is clean, unbiased, and representative of real-world conditions. Poor training data leads to poor AI performance.
